hi, please can you tell me a little bit more about your set up? i have a pair of 183's that have spawned once, but wont do it again!

did you trigger them into it, by a cool water change, or did they just do it of there own free will?
User avatar
KrisA
Posts: 77
Joined: 16 Sep 2009, 00:59
My cats species list: 1 (i:1, k:0)
My BLogs: 1 (i:4, p:68)
Location 2: Denmark

Re: Follow my L183.

Post by KrisA »

yes i'll trigger them to spawn by stoping water changes for 2 weeks,
after i'll change alot of cold water about 50% each day for 3-4 days,
then they spawn if they are feeded well :)
